    Project Details

    The Chenab Rail Bridge, situated between Bakkal and Kauri in the Reasi district of Jammu and Kashmir, stands as an engineering marvel. Soaring 359 meters above the riverbed, it claims the title of the world's highest rail-arch bridge. With an impressive arch span of 467 meters and a total length of 1,315 meters, it ranks as the seventh longest single-span bridge globally, exclusively for broad-gauge rail lines. This monumental bridge is an integral part of the Jammu-Udhampur-Srinagar-Baramulla Rail Line (JUSBRL) project, a monumental endeavor led by the Indian Ministry of Railways. The JUSBRL project encompasses numerous tunnels and bridges in a challenging, rugged, and mountainous terrain characterized by complex Himalayan geology.

    The completion of this bridge will revolutionize travel in the region, reducing the current 12-hour journey between destinations to a mere six hours. This transformation is expected to stimulate the local economy and facilitate seamless connectivity between Jammu and Kashmir's summer and winter capitals, fostering both development and weather resilience.
